Why Brakeless?

I set to on my bike yesterday and removed the brakes again, why? Because I actually feel it makes me a better rider. I went back to where I filmed my brakeless vid on the Zoot the other day and tried some of the same lines and found myself relying on the brakes to get up rocks and stay up, which also meant a lot of the time I didn't make it as I was putting in less effort. When you've got no brakes you've got to put in that bit more, just to make sure cause there's no contingency plan, no lifeline there to hold you on the edge whilst you give it another little hop.
I'll be the first to admit that although partly because I was skint and couldn't afford to finish my build the main reason I went brakeless is cause I thought it would make me look cool. I've seen other riders doing it who I admired and wanted to be like them and gain there respect but now after having a go I can see the reason behind it. I think everyone should have a go at riding brakeless, but not just for a day you have to give it a couple of weeks, and you don't have to be riding a 24 or a street bike just look at Flipp. He can do more on a mod without brakes than most of us can do on any bike with!
